
Spend $199 on a mobile handset and $35 to $225 on monthly service fees, and what you'll get is unlimited access to sports news in the palm of your hand.
Mobile ESPN, which the sports titan says has been "built from the ground up for sports fans, by sports fans," is now available in more than 700 Best Buy store across the country.
Services include access to breaking sports news, up-to-the-minute scoreboards, ESPN video footage, and other goodies. The somewhat clunky-looking Sanyo flip-phone features a super speedy EV-DO network connection, a 1.3-megapixel camera, and a MP3/AAC player. It also has an E button that connects directly to ESPN's Web site.
